Jason Tartickis not here for any hateful remarks about his fiancéeKaitlyn Bristowe’s appearance.
The formerBachelorettecontestant continued, “I just don’t see why people have to do that. The other thing is, I honestly feel like it’s more the fact that it’s usually women putting other women down [that] is just insane.”
Tartick remarked that fans didn’t criticizeChris Harrison’s appearance during his 19 years hostingThe Bachelorfranchise. “I just think it’s absolutely ridiculous, and I don’t know why people think it’s okay,” he said. “People see it, people hear it and they feel it. And whether they show it or not, it’s got to end. It’s insane.”
While acknowledging that they’ve all “been blessed” to be a part of the ABC franchise, Tartick said “with the bad comes [the] good.”

“When you see some of the bad … like, ‘Oh, she’s aged,’ Well, yeah, we all f—ing age,” Tartick said. “We all age. We all die, that’s inevitable.”
Bristowe herself recently hit back ata Twitter userquestioning what was “different” about her looks. “6 years since I was on the show, brow lift, brow micro blading, got my teeth bonded, some filler in my lips,” the former Bachelorettetweeted. “Aging, darker hair, and I finally learned how to contour. Oh and I put on some weight, flexed biceps.”
Also responding to an individualwho suggestedher face was “busted,” Bristowe, 36,wrote: “So sick of women commenting on my face. Jesus.”
Bristowe and Tartickgot engaged in Mayafter over two years together; Tartick recently told PEOPLE thatwedding planning was underway.
“We are full speed ahead, which is so exciting,” he said. “And we’re both so excited about the next steps of our lives.”
